How to add a link in bio, step by step

To add a link in bio, open your profile's edit screen and paste your URL into the website or links field: Instagram supports up to five links via Edit profile, TikTok exposes a Website field for Business accounts, and YouTube uses channel links plus per-video description links. It takes under a minute per platform. To earn from it, point those links at affiliate offers.

Instagram

Instagram supports up to five links directly in your profile.

  • Open your profile and tap Edit profile
  • Tap Links, then Add external link
  • Paste your URL and add a clear title
  • Repeat for up to five links, ordered by priority
  • Save — the links appear under your bio

TikTok

TikTok shows a clickable Website field once your account qualifies. Switching to a free Business account is the easiest way to unlock it.

  • Open Settings and privacy, then Account, and switch to a Business account if needed
  • Go back to your profile and tap Edit profile
  • Tap Website and paste your URL
  • Save — the link appears under your bio

YouTube

YouTube gives you channel links plus clickable links in every video description.

  • In YouTube Studio, open Customization, then Basic info
  • Add your channel links and order them by priority
  • In each video's description, paste the links relevant to that video near the top
  • Save — channel links show on your banner and About tab

Sending to multiple destinations

Where a platform gives you only one link (like TikTok), point that URL at a simple landing page that lists your destinations. Instagram's native multi-link and YouTube's description links often remove the need for a separate tool entirely.

Either way, keep the list short and lead with the one action you most want a new follower to take.

FAQ

Common questions

How do I add a link in bio on Instagram?+

Tap Edit profile, then Links, then Add external link. Paste your URL, add a title, and save. You can add up to five links, ordered by priority.

How do I add a link in bio on TikTok?+

Switch to a free Business account under Settings and privacy if needed, then open Edit profile, tap Website, paste your URL, and save.

How do I add links on YouTube?+

Use YouTube Studio, Customization, Basic info to add channel links, and paste relevant links into each video's description near the top.

Why can't I add a link to my bio?+

Usually it is a platform requirement — TikTok's clickable link needs an eligible or Business account. Check that you are in the right field (website/links) and meet any account requirements.

Do I need an app to add a link in bio?+

No. You can add links natively on all three platforms. A separate landing-page tool only helps when you want more links or richer layouts than the platform allows.
